In episode 60 of PodSpot, Jon Pittham speaks with Maxime Lauricella, Core Partner Development Manager at HubSpot, to delve into the transformative power of using HubSpot to revolutionise business development strategies. This episode uncovers how leveraging AI, CRM, and personalised client engagement can significantly enhance your business development efforts.

The discussion kicks off with an exploration of the pivotal role Business Development Managers (BDMs) and Business Development Representatives (BDRs) play in driving stronger conversations and creating opportunities through improved outreach strategies. Jon and Maxime emphasise the importance of moving away from generic messaging and highlight the necessity of personalising outreach efforts to resonate with different decision-makers. They discuss common pitfalls that BDs face, such as spending excessive time on administrative tasks, which can detract from the ability to make genuine human connections.

Maxime shares insights into how data and automation can enhance CRM effectiveness, especially through HubSpot's capabilities. The conversation reveals how AI is revolutionising the way businesses identify high-converting prospects, and how tools like email open notifications can facilitate proactive and successful client engagements. A real-world case study is shared, demonstrating the value of enriched data and transparency in communication, leading to successful sales outcomes.

The episode further explores the impact of AI on sales and business development, with a focus on how HubSpot and other AI tools like ChatGPT are reshaping traditional processes. The emerging field of Revenue Operations (RevOps) is also discussed, highlighting its importance in aligning people, technology, data, and processes to drive business growth. Maxime and Jon emphasise the significance of using a unified platform like HubSpot to streamline operations across departments, providing a comprehensive view of data that enhances team collaboration and customer relationships.

In the concluding segments, practical advice is offered to BDMs and BDRs in competitive markets. The discussion centers around maintaining a client-focused mindset, leveraging AI for prospecting, and utilising effective communication strategies to build meaningful connections with clients. Jon reflects on the lessons from his early sales career, underscoring the importance of recognising the value of a great product and the impact it has on helping people.
